Job Summary: We are looking for an experienced and motivated individual to join our Legal and Compliance team supporting our regulatory and compliance function across all locations and brands. The Regulatory Specialist will be responsible for state level compliance including but not limited to maintenance of state alcohol licensing, state brands registrations and state reporting, as well as supporting additional administrative and organizational task as needed.

The Regulatory Specialist will report to the Director of Compliance for the Beverage Division.

This role is open to our locations in Atlanta/Portland/Bend/NYC/Littleton.

Roles and Responsibilities:

  • Alongside the Director of Compliance, maintain out-of-state shipper licenses across the alcoholic beverage division, including renewals and record-keeping.
  • Manage state brand registration submissions and communication with state regulatory agencies. This includes the submission of new registrations, updating existing registrations, and tracking and maintaining renewals across all brands.
  • Maintain and update internal tracking of state brand registrations that serves as single point of information across functions.
  • Manage state reporting for out-of-state shipper’s licenses, submit monthly reports in all states and monitor and respond to requests for information and/or invoices from regulatory agencies.
  • Communicate with Sales and Business Development teams to provide updates on state level compliance as needed.
  • Support Director of Compliance with other compliance and legal matters.
  • Perform regulatory research and assist in ensuring state compliance requirements are updated when necessary.

Qualifications:

  • Bachelor’s or Associate’s degree from an accredited institution
  • 2+ years’ experience in alcoholic beverage industry
  • Knowledge of the three-tier system and state alcohol beverage compliance
  • Familiarity with navigating regulatory portals
  • Experience interfacing with government regulators
  • Familiarity with Microsoft Office (Excel, Word, Teams, PowerPoint, SharePoint, etc.) solutions
  • Ability to generate, manipulate, and decipher reporting data as it relates to CPG sales
  • Experience with Ship Compliant or a similar software a strong plus
  • Experience with OBeer or similar software a strong plus
